Output 573229213e6afe62e40b0ea26fd1d160d3818e4bbc7e8566148e6a2218a12597:1

value
46890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 500d51c8f5beb3005644599d5d52ada655ef9270 OP_EQUAL
address
38zHwLsMcDqirfjcqyFbVtyPkR9e2sQsoH
transaction
573229213e6afe62e40b0ea26fd1d160d3818e4bbc7e8566148e6a2218a12597
spent
true